Vicki Quade is putting her hit comedy platform to work to help Ukrainian refugees. Her production company Nuns4Fun Entertainment is collecting funds at all performances to help the Sisters of the Holy Family of Nazareth aid refugees in Poland and Ukraine. Enjoy Late Night Catechism, Easter Bunny Bingo: Jesus, Resurrection & Peeps, and Bible Bingo at the Greenhouse Theater Center or donate directly at nazarethcsfn.org.

Cathryn Michon and W. Bruce Cameron are donating all proceeds from the “A Dog’s Courage Tour” to UAnimals, helping animals on the ground in Ukraine and to Best Friends Animal Society.
